Understanding Late Infantile Neuronal Ceroid Lipofuscinosis (LINCL) Treatment
Late Infantile Neuronal Ceroid Lipofuscinosis (LINCL), also known as CLN2 disease, is a rare, progressive, and fatal neurodegenerative genetic disorder. It primarily affects children, leading to a decline in motor, cognitive, and visual functions. While there is no cure, significant advancements in treatment and supportive care aim to slow disease progression, manage symptoms, and improve the quality of life for affected individuals and their families. 1. Enzyme Replacement Therapy (ERT) for CLN2 Disease
A cornerstone of late infantile neuronal ceroid lipofuscinosis treatment is enzyme replacement therapy (ERT). For CLN2 disease, this involves cerliponase alfa (marketed as Brineura). This specific therapy aims to replace the deficient tripeptidyl peptidase 1 (TPP1) enzyme, which is responsible for breaking down certain proteins and lipids within cells. Without functional TPP1, these substances accumulate, leading to neuronal damage. Cerliponase alfa is administered directly into the brain's cerebrospinal fluid through an intracerebroventricular access device, typically every two weeks. Studies have shown that this treatment can slow the progression of motor and language decline in children with CLN2 disease.
2. Managing Seizures and Neurological Symptoms
Seizures are a prominent and often early symptom of LINCL. Effective management of seizures is a critical component of treatment. This typically involves the use of antiepileptic medications, which are carefully selected and adjusted by neurologists to control seizure frequency and severity. Beyond seizures, other neurological symptoms such as spasticity, dystonia, and sleep disturbances also require attention. Medications, physical therapy, and other interventions may be employed to alleviate these symptoms and improve comfort and function.
3. Addressing Developmental and Motor Regression
As LINCL progresses, children experience significant developmental and motor regression, losing previously acquired skills. A multidisciplinary team including physical therapists, occupational therapists, and speech therapists plays a vital role. Physical therapy helps maintain mobility, prevent contractures, and manage spasticity. Occupational therapy focuses on adapting daily activities and providing assistive devices to enhance independence. Speech therapy addresses communication difficulties and swallowing problems, which are common as the disease advances. Early and consistent therapeutic interventions are essential to support development and maintain functional abilities for as long as possible.
4. Nutritional Support and Gastronomy
Feeding difficulties, including dysphagia (difficulty swallowing) and poor appetite, are common in children with LINCL due to neurological decline. Ensuring adequate nutrition and hydration is paramount. When oral feeding becomes unsafe or insufficient, a gastrostomy tube (G-tube) may be recommended. This allows for direct delivery of nutrition and medication into the stomach, reducing the risk of aspiration and ensuring proper caloric intake. Nutritional support is carefully monitored and adjusted by dietitians to meet the child's evolving needs.
5. Vision and Hearing Care
Progressive vision loss, often leading to blindness, is a characteristic feature of LINCL. Regular ophthalmological evaluations are necessary to monitor changes and provide appropriate support, such as low-vision aids or environmental adaptations. Hearing impairment can also occur, necessitating audiological assessments. While vision and hearing loss are part of the disease progression, addressing these sensory challenges helps improve communication, interaction, and overall engagement with the environment, enhancing the child's quality of life.
6. Palliative and Supportive Care for Quality of Life
Palliative care is an integral part of late infantile neuronal ceroid lipofuscinosis treatment from the time of diagnosis. It focuses on providing comfort, managing pain, and addressing the physical, psychological, and spiritual needs of the child and family. This includes managing symptoms like pain, irritability, and respiratory issues. Supportive care also extends to psychological and social support for families, helping them cope with the emotional toll of the disease. The goal is to maximize the child's comfort and dignity throughout their journey, ensuring the best possible quality of life.
